Step by Step Tutorial: How to Add Location in Google Map

Before you get started, make sure you have the Google Maps app downloaded on your smartphone or you’re using the Google Maps website on a computer. You will also need a Google account to add a location.

Step 1: Open Google Maps

Open Google Maps on your device or computer.

When you open Google Maps, make sure you’re signed in with your Google account. If you’re using a smartphone, the app will use your current location to start. If you’re on a computer, you might need to manually navigate to the area where you want to add the location.

Step 2: Find the Location You Want to Add

Navigate to the location you want to add on the map.

You can search for a specific address or use the zoom and scroll features to find the precise spot. If you’re adding a location that doesn’t have an address, like a trail in a park, you’ll need to zoom in close enough to place the marker accurately.

Step 3: Add the Location

Click or tap on the spot where you want to add the location, then select “Add a missing place.”

A form will pop up asking for details about the location. You’ll need to fill in as much information as possible, including the name, category, and address. If you’re adding a business, you can also include hours of operation, phone number, and website.

Step 4: Submit for Review

Once you’ve filled in the information, click “Send” to submit the location for review.

Google will review the information you’ve provided to make sure it’s accurate. This process can take anywhere from a few hours to a few days. Once approved, the location will appear on Google Maps for everyone to see and use.

Tips: How to Add Location in Google Map Successfully

  • Make sure the location you’re adding doesn’t already exist on the map to avoid duplicates.
  • Provide as much detail as possible when adding a location to increase the chances of it being approved quickly.
  • Add photos of the location if you have them, as this helps verify the location’s existence and provides visual aid to other users.
  • If you’re adding a business, make sure to include keywords in the description that people might use to search for your services.
  • Check back after a few days to see if your submission has been added, and if not, you can submit an inquiry to Google for an update.

Frequently Asked Questions

How long does it take for a new location to be approved by Google?

It can take anywhere from a few hours to a few days for Google to review and approve a new location.

Can I add any location to Google Maps?

Yes, you can add any public location to Google Maps, but it must be a place that doesn’t already exist on the map.

What should I do if my location submission is denied?

If your location submission is denied, review the information you provided for accuracy and completeness, then resubmit.

Is it possible to edit a location once it’s been added to Google Maps?

Yes, you can suggest edits to a location on Google Maps if you notice any incorrect or outdated information.

Can I add a location without a Google account?

No, you need to be signed in with a Google account to add a location to Google Maps.
